			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://pastorshawn.com/whats-often-under-greener-grass/attachment/011/" rel="attachment wp-att-2265"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-2265" title="011" src="http://pastorshawn.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/011-300x296.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="296" /></a>I learned as a kid that the grass is always greener over the septic tank. The toughest part of our lawn to mow was the patch directly above the septic tank. The grass there grew thick, tall, and hearty. It looked great, but was hard to maintain. When I thought about what was underneath too much, it really grossed me out!</p>
<p>Our choices in life can have similar hidden nastiness underneath what looks to be a great “greener grass” opportunity. Greener grass is not always a bad thing. But, when we make choices based on a longing look, an impulsive decision, and a quick move, often the greener grass simply distracts us from the bad stuff hidden under the surface.</p>
<p>As we continue our study of the life of Abraham in our series of messages entitled <em>The Faith-Based Life</em> this Sunday at Calvary, we will see a strong contrast between the decision-making process of Abraham and that of his nephew Lot. In Genesis 13:5-18, Lot seeks contentment and satisfaction in a “greener grass” opportunity while Abraham roots his contentment in the Lord. The stark difference between the two becomes obvious in the choices they make and the consequences that follow those choices.</p>
<p>Lot makes 6 choices that ruin his life. Abraham lives the faith-based life. Lot lives the flesh-based life. The discernment they each display reflects their individual walks with God. The contrast could not be stronger.</p>
<p>Unfortunately, often well-intentioned, nice Christians today constantly make the same bad choices Lot made. Many of the followers of Christ never experience the joy God intends because they make terrible everyday choices in life. The world rarely sees the contentment and blessing of being a Christ-follower because the followers of Jesus far too often follow the same path as Lot.</p>
<p>Sunday we will explore the dangers of discernment and contentment being based on the greener grass of life. We will see the nastiness that often hides under the surface in the septic tank. We will also see the blessing of Abraham’s contentedness in His God and how we too can enjoy that same sweet satisfaction in life every day!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We landed yesterday at 7am. Worship, Pastor Dongo&#8217;s daughter, picked us up at the airport. We went to the hotel, cleaned up, unpacked a bit and then Pastor Dongo picked us up. We headed over to the God Cares Primary School. The kids were on lunch break and as we exited the car a small &#8220;riot&#8221; ensued. They surrounded us and loved on us.</p>
<p>We got to help serve lunch from the current kitchen and got to walk through the new kitchen under construction. In the pictures you can see Lesli and the kids serving the 800+ kids their lunch.</p>
<p>We took a tour of the school and met staff and students. As you can see in the pics, our kids fell in love with the children.</p>
<p>Also, attached are photos of Pastor and Mrs (Florence) Dongo with Lesli and me.</p>
<p>Today we will be visiting the God Cares High School and all of us will be helping lead in the chapel there.</p>
<p>Enjoy the pics. Pray for Lesli. The Malaria pills make her very sick. Lesli gets sick to her stomach for about 2 hours after taking them. Unusual for her, she is usually the one who never gets sick. Megan and Katie have also been a bit sick after taking the malaria pills.</p>

<p><strong>Song Lyrics of &#8220;<em>The Solid Rock</em>&#8220;</strong></p>
<p>My hope is built on nothing less<br />
Than Jesus’ blood and righteousness.<br />
I dare not trust the sweetest frame,<br />
But wholly trust in Jesus’ Name.</p>
<p>When darkness seems to hide His lovely face,<br />
I rest on His unchanging grace.<br />
In every high and stormy gale,<br />
My anchor holds within the veil.</p>
<p>On Christ the solid Rock I stand,<br />
All other ground is sinking sand;<br />
All other ground is sinking sand.</p>
<p>His oath, His covenant, His blood,<br />
Support me in the whelming flood.<br />
When all around my soul gives way,<br />
He then is all my Hope and Stay.</p>
<p>On Christ the solid Rock I stand,<br />
All other ground is sinking sand;<br />
All other ground is sinking sand.</p>
<p>When He shall come with trumpet sound,<br />
Oh may I then in Him be found.<br />
Dressed in His righteousness alone,<br />
Faultless to stand before the throne.</p>
<p>On Christ the solid Rock I stand,<br />
All other ground is sinking sand;<br />
All other ground is sinking sand.<br />
On Christ the solid Rock I stand,<br />
All other ground is sinking sand;<br />
All other ground is sinking sand.</p>
